logo

Output 62d1292473c95741d429fdac37300a6f50e513a149445973a3937b50f8a82c35:0

value
6874914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3e510d453c54fdbbc6a1aee536768dbfd161dce OP_EQUAL
address
3KYp6iZJ2iSpNXAQewYyLWQ3qb574G8on7
transaction
62d1292473c95741d429fdac37300a6f50e513a149445973a3937b50f8a82c35